Banda Aceh: Gunfire near UN headquarters
AP ^

Posted on 01/08/2005 7:13:21 PM PST by ddtorque

Suspected rebels fired shots early Sunday at the home of a top police official near the United Nations' relief headquarters in the tsunami-ravaged Indonesian city of Banda Aceh, officials said. There were no casualties.

An unspecified number of Free Aceh Movement rebels fired at officers guarding the home of Aceh province's deputy police chief, located about 100 meters from the UN building, said police Sgt. Bambang Hariyanpo.

Police returned fire but the rebels vanished into the city, he said, adding authorities were investigating the incident.

Police and UN officials said the UN's relief headquarters was not the target of the shooting, in which there were no casualties.
